ITMN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

176 of the 3,475 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in INTERMUNE INC (ITMN)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$3.38B — up 160% from $1.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 65 funds opened new ITMN positions and 17 closed out — a net gain of 48 holders — while 57 added to existing stakes and 42 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Baker Bros. Advisors, adding an estimated $93M. The largest seller was OrbiMed, cutting an estimated $38.9M.
